无源毫米波成像技术是通过探测被测场景及目标在毫米波段的自然辐射实现成像的。
Passive millimeter-wave (PMMW) imaging technology forms images by detecting natural occurring millimeter-wave radiation from the scene and targets.
无源毫米波成像技术在战场侦察、反恐探测、安检等军事、民事应用领域具有重要的实用价值。
PMMW imaging technology has been applied widely in military affairs and civil applications such as battlefield reconnoitering, anti-terror detecting and security scanning.
针对无源毫米波成像中图像分辨率低的问题,提出了一种改进的最大后验(MAP)超分辨算法。
To solve the problem of poor resolution in passive millimeter wave (PMMW) imaging, we present an improved maximum a posteriori (MAP) super-resolution algorithm.
